For people diagnosed with cancer, radiation therapy can be an important part of their treatment. At Baystate’s D’Amour Center for Cancer Care, many of those patients are greeted by Kemani Harriott, a radiation therapist who utilizes a medical linear accelerator to deliver precise, targeted radiation treatments. While the technology plays a critical role, she knows it's the human connection that patients often remember most. Guiding people through one of the most difficult times in their lives is what makes her work so meaningful, and providing compassionate, skilled care is the part of the job she loves most.

“I feel honored to work in a field where every day I am helping people to feel relaxed and more comfortable,” she says, “providing both clinical and emotional support.”

A medical linear accelerator customizes high-energy X-rays or electrons to conform to a tumor's shape and destroy cancer cells while sparing surrounding normal tissue. This type of radiation therapy can be used to treat numerous types of cancers, including prostate, breast, lung, and brain cancers. Most patients are unaware – and pleasantly surprised – to learn that each radiation appointment only takes about 15 minutes. This brief treatment window is made possible thanks to a series of precise steps taken by a planning team who collaborate to ensure treatment is as safe and effective as possible.

Before a patient ever begins treatment, Kemani works with physicians, dosimetrists, medical physicists and others who create a customized treatment plan. Patients start with an initial CT planning scan ordered by their physician. Taking the information the scan provides, dosimetrists determine how to best apply the dose that was prescribed by the physician to a targeted area and how to minimize the dosage effects on surrounding structures. Medical physicists run this plan through the linear accelerator, making sure the machine gives the correct output. During the treatment visit, radiation therapists like Kemani carefully position patients, aligning them to millimeter accuracy, and repeatedly use the machine’s built-in safety features to ensure the dosage is correct for each patient.

Many radiation therapy treatment plans involve daily visits on weekdays over the course of 6-8 weeks, giving Kemani a chance to get to know patients and provide ongoing support to them. Some are looking for conversation and distraction, others for reassurance.

“I feel honored to be able to share the details, step by step, about what is going to happen,” says Kemani. “I try to put myself in their shoes. I feel this is a calling, to be able to be a support for them and help them feel less nervous.”

Some patients have formed such bonds that they come back to visit Kemani and other members of the team after their treatment is complete, just to say hi and catch up on how life is going. One patient, Kemani remembers fondly, even made her a certificate after he completed treatment, thanking her for her help through the process.

Kemani is in her fourth year as a radiation therapist at Baystate – her first job after graduating from a college radiation therapy program in Connecticut. She had thought about pursuing a healthcare career, and her everyday experiences with patients help confirm she made the right decision.

Whether it’s the role she plays in helping to treat their cancer, or the comfort and camaraderie she can provide when patients are nervous and afraid, “it’s heartwarming to know that I am making an impact,” she says.
